Rockland County held its annual 9/11 remembrance ceremony at Haverstraw Bay Park, honoring the lives lost 23 years ago.

Hundreds attended, including family members who read the names of their loved ones.

A tolling of the bell marked the moments of the attacks and the World Trade Center towers' collapse.

The ceremony also paid respects to the 1993 World Trade Center bombing victim from Rockland.

Attendees left roses near the names of those they knew.

"It's remarkable it's been this long," said Kelly Manzi of Valley Cottage. "I hope as a country, as a world, we can come together in peace."

Additional ceremonies are scheduled throughout the evening.
